Prior to the date of hire, applicants must undergo a fingerprint test by the Department of Justice, pass a medical examination, which may include a drug screening, and possibly a psychological evaluation, sign a constitutional oath, and submit proof of U.S. citizenship or legal right to remain and work in the U.S.
For some positions, applicants may also be required to submit proof of age, undergo a background investigation, which may include a credit check, voice stress analysis, and/or a polygraph, and/or be bonded.
